Baseball Topped at Washington State

Baseball Topped at Washington State

PULLMAN, Wash. – Santa Clara baseball lost its Saturday game 8-3 at Washington State.

The Broncos (18-15) briefly held a lead after scoring three in the second but the Cougars (24-13) came right back to tie it in the bottom of the frame. They would then add single runs in the fourth, fifth, and eighth innings and two in the sixth.

Jonah Advincula and Jacob McKeon both had two RBIs out of the top two spots in the lineup. Advincula scored twice with McKeon having a three-hit day. Sam Brown had a pair of doubles and an RBI with Kyle Russell also adding two hits.

Grant Taylor (3-2) went 5 innings in the start to collect the win. He allowed three runs on two hits with four walks and six strikeouts. Caden Kaelber tossed the final 4 innings to get his second save of the year.

Santa Clara got two hits and two RBIs from Dawson Brigman out of the leadoff spot. Robert Hipwell and Malcolm Williams also added singles with Johnny Luetzow picking up an RBI.

Nick Sando (1-3) took the loss in a 4 inning start. He surrendered four runs on five hits with two strikeouts.
